首页 > 精选范文 >

调试工程师是干嘛的

2025-10-31 02:32:26

问题描述:

调试工程师是干嘛的,跪求好心人,帮我度过难关!

最佳答案

推荐答案

2025-10-31 02:32:26

调试工程师是干嘛的】调试工程师是软件开发过程中不可或缺的角色,主要负责发现和解决程序中的错误或缺陷。他们的工作贯穿于软件开发的各个阶段,从开发初期到产品发布后,都起着至关重要的作用。以下是关于调试工程师职责和技能的详细总结。

一、调试工程师的主要职责

职责内容 说明
代码审查 检查代码逻辑是否合理,是否存在潜在问题
错误排查 使用调试工具定位并分析程序运行时的异常
日志分析 查看系统日志、应用日志以判断问题根源
测试支持 协助测试人员进行功能验证和回归测试
性能优化 分析系统性能瓶颈,提出优化建议
文档编写 记录调试过程和解决方案,便于后续参考

二、调试工程师的核心技能

技能类别 具体技能
编程能力 熟练掌握至少一种编程语言(如Java、Python、C++等)
调试工具 熟悉常用调试工具(如GDB、Visual Studio Debugger、Chrome DevTools等)
问题分析 具备良好的逻辑思维和问题定位能力
系统知识 了解操作系统、网络协议、数据库等基础知识
沟通能力 能与开发、测试、运维等多角色协作沟通
学习能力 快速掌握新技术和工具,适应不同项目需求

三、调试工程师的工作流程

1. 接收问题报告:从测试团队或用户处获取问题描述。

2. 复现问题:尝试在本地环境复现问题现象。

3. 定位原因:使用调试工具逐步执行代码,查找问题源头。

4. 修复问题:根据分析结果修改代码或配置。

5. 验证修复:重新测试确认问题已解决。

6. 提交文档:记录整个调试过程和解决方案。

四、调试工程师的重要性

- 提高产品质量:通过及时发现和修复问题,提升软件稳定性。

- 缩短开发周期:减少因错误导致的返工和延误。

- 保障用户体验:确保软件在不同环境下正常运行,提升用户满意度。

总之,调试工程师虽然不直接参与产品设计,但他们是保证软件质量的重要力量。他们不仅需要扎实的技术功底,还需要耐心和细致的工作态度,才能在复杂的问题中找到突破口。

以上就是【调试工程师是干嘛的】相关内容,希望对您有所帮助。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。